Jessie J Teases New Single 'Wild' in Acoustic Video
Music

The British dance-pop star previews her new single by dropping an acoustic rendition teaser of 'Wild'.

AceShowbiz -

"Domino" singer Jessie J is unleashing her new single "Wild" featuring Big Sean and Dizzee Rascal but fans would have to content themselves for now with the one-minute teaser clip of the new song. The 25-year-old entertainer offers the short acoustic rendition of the track as a preview of the full version.

"Wild" will be the first single off Jessie J's forthcoming sophomore album, which she is putting together with the help of Dr. Luke, Ammo and Claude Kelly. She made the announcement after her live performance of "Domino" on the finale of "American Idol" last week, singing with season twelve finalist Angie Miller who puts the Brit as her own personal idol and whom Jessie J personally invited to join her on her summer tour in the U.K.

Posting a message on her Twitter page last night, "The Voice UK" mentor Jessie J told fans to visit her official site to catch the teaser clip. "It's scary opening yourself up to the world, to create intrigue around your life. It's also the most exhilarating feeling to feel free," she tweeted along with the word "intrigue."

"Jessie is doing something that right now would probably be unheard of in that she's not apologizing for big vocals," album producer Kelly revealed about the artist. "It's a lot of big vocals, a lot of vocal tricks, but still huge pop choruses."
